Book Introduction

  • Book Title: Corporate Chanakya
  • Author: Radhakrishna Pillai, an expert in management and an international consultant.
  • Focus: Connects ancient wisdom (from Chanakya) to modern business practices.
  • Key Idea: The book discusses successful management strategies based on Chanakya's ancient principles.

About Chanakya

  • Historical Context: A sage and leader from the 4th century BC.
  • Contributions: Developed theories on leadership, governance, and corporate ethics.
  • Original Work: Composed of 6000 sutras and 150 chapters.
  • Role: Instrumental in establishing the Maurya dynasty and mentoring Chandragupta Maurya.

Key Themes from "Corporate Chanakya"

  1. Seven Pillars of Business Success (from Kautilya's Arthashastra):

    • Swami: The King/Leader
    • Amatya: The Minister/Manager
    • Janapada: The Country/Market
    • Durga: The Fortified City/Infrastructure
    • Kosha: The Treasury/Finance
    • Danda: The Army/Team
    • Mitra: The Allies/Mentors
  2. Three Core Aspects Identified by Pillai:

    • Leadership: Backbone of successful business. Importance of a competent leader.
    • Management: Efficient management of resources (people, processes, products).
    • Training: Essential for transforming individuals from unskilled to skilled.

Leadership Insights

  • Power: Gained through knowledge, intellectual capacity, financial stability, and control over one's senses.
  • Qualities of a Leader:
    • Ability to engage and motivate team members.
    • Must avoid intoxication by power.
    • Time management is crucial.
    • Bravery, quickness, and agility are essential traits.

Management Insights

  • Importance of Employees:

    • Focus on safety, security, and satisfaction of employees.
    • Promotion of teamwork and accountability.
  • Finance Management:

    • Importance of profit margins and risk management.
  • Teamwork: Shift from hard work to smart work to teamwork.
